The Kitchen Supervisor oversees the day to day activities in the kitchen to ensure all activities take place without concern.
Responsibilities
QUALIFICATIONS:
High School Diploma or equivalent and at least 1 year of experience in stewarding kitchen maintenance kitchen operations or similar with at least one year experience in a supervisory capacity.
Knowledge of food and beverage service operation preferred.
Complies with certification requirements as applicable for position to include: Food Handlers Alcohol Awareness CPR and First Aid
Demonstrates familiarity with all Aimbridge Hospitality policies and house rules as well as hospitality terminology.
Has or can acquire Food Manager Certification (applicable state).
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:
Approaches all encounters with guests and associates in a friendly service oriented manner.
Controls and analyzes cost breakage and quality support provided to outlets banquets and other areas of all china glass and silver. Assists the Executive Chef maintain the culinary supplies.
Monitors condition and cleanliness of equipment
Monitors condition and cleanliness of all kitchen areas.
Participates in the preparation of the annual stewarding operating budget which supports the overall objectives of the Food & Beverage Department
Educates associates on current safety issues to ensure compliance with all health and safety regulations.
Informs management of hazardous situations emergencies or threats to security of guests employees or hotel assets
Determines the minimum and maximum stock and control the par stocks of all materials and equipment.
Leads supervises and directs the Stewarding department and prepares/conducts performance evaluations.
Ensures all kitchen associates fulfill their job functions appropriately.
Ensures the highest levels of sanitation and cleanliness of all facilities and equipment.
Ensures the proper handling of all chemicals.
Attends meetings as necessary.
Assists with other duties as needed which may include but is not limited to providing assistance with food dish-up completing set-up sheets etc.
Maintains open communication with other departments.
